The typical American commute has been getting longer each year since 2010. The average one-way commute in Lake Holiday takes 21.9 minutes. That's shorter than the US average of 26.4 minutes.

How people in Lake Holiday get to work:
- 82.4% drive their own car alone
- 15.5% carpool with others
- 2.1% work from home
- 0.0% take mass transit
